Cyber Defense Operations Hub (Ops Hub) is looking for motivated and experienced Sr. Security Operations Engineer to join our growing team to coordinate Microsoft’s response to the most critical security issues facing our customers. When you read about hackers in the news; when the integrity of our products are at stake; or when a zero-day exploit is being used to attack customers, the Ops Hub team works across Microsoft to rapidly defend the company and its customers against these threats. Job Responsibility:

  • Perform cyber defense incident and/or vulnerability triage to determine scope, urgency, and potential risk impact
  • Make high-stake decisions that enable expeditious remediation of risk to protect customers and Microsoft
  • Track and document cyber defense incidents from initial escalation through final resolution
  • Provide tactical security decisions and coordinate enterprise-wide cyber defenders to resolve incidents
  • Send timely and clear executive updates explaining the risk to customers and Microsoft
  • Advise and validate customer notifications and/or authoritative security guidance for customers
  • Conduct incident analysis, produce reports, and briefs informing threat landscape trends and future investment areas to improve security
